Sourcing guidance for Manhole Cover Making Machine
What are the key technical specifications to consider when selecting a manhole cover making machine?
Buyers must prioritize the clamping force (tonnage) and injection/pressing capacity based on the material type (e.g., composite BMC/SMC, ductile iron, or polymer). For composite machines, ensure the heating plate parallelism is within 0.05mm to prevent uneven thickness. For hydraulic systems, look for servo-motor integration, which can reduce energy consumption by 30-50% compared to traditional induction motors.
Which material-specific technologies should I look for in these machines?
If you are producing SMC (Sheet Molding Compound) covers, the machine must feature a high-precision PLC control system to manage multi-stage pressure and temperature curves. For ductile iron production, focus on the automatic molding line's compatibility with existing furnace outputs. Ensure the machine supports customizable molds for various shapes (round, square, triangular) and load-bearing classes ranging from A15 to F900 according to international standards.
What compliance and safety standards are mandatory for this industrial equipment?
The machine itself should carry a CE marking for the European market or UL certification for North America. More importantly, the output products must meet EN 124 standards (the global benchmark for gully tops and manhole tops). Verify that the supplier provides safety light curtains and emergency stop interlocks to comply with ISO 12100:2010 for machinery safety.
How can I evaluate the production efficiency and ROI of the machine?
Calculate the cycle time per unit; high-efficiency hydraulic presses should complete a standard cover cycle in 180 to 300 seconds depending on material thickness. Request a Total Cost of Ownership (TCO) analysis that includes mold maintenance costs, power consumption per hour, and spare parts availability. A machine with a lower scrap rate (under 2%) will significantly improve long-term profitability.
Cross-Border Procurement Strategy for Heavy Machinery
How should I manage the risks of purchasing heavy industrial machinery from overseas?
Conduct a factory audit or hire a third-party inspector (like SGS or Intertek) to verify the supplier's manufacturing capacity on Made-in-China.com. Use Trade Assurance or Letter of Credit (L/C) to ensure payment is only released upon verification of the Bill of Lading and Pre-shipment Inspection (PSI) report.
What are the best practices for shipping and installing a manhole cover making machine?
Due to the extreme weight, these machines require Flat Rack or Open Top containers. Ensure the supplier uses heavy-duty anti-rust oil and vacuum plastic packaging to prevent sea-salt corrosion. Negotiate for on-site installation and commissioning services, or at minimum, a detailed video installation guide and 24/7 remote technical support.
How do I negotiate effectively with specialized machinery suppliers?
Focus the negotiation on the warranty period for core components (like hydraulic pumps and PLC units) rather than just the sticker price. Ask for a wear-parts package (seals, heaters, sensors) to be included for the first 2 years of operation. What international trade policies should I be aware of for this category?
Check for anti-dumping duties on cast iron products in your specific country, as this may influence whether you buy a machine for composite covers vs. iron covers. Ensure the HS Code (typically 8477.59 or 8462.91) is correctly declared to avoid customs delays and to benefit from any applicable Free Trade Agreement (FTA) tariff reductions.
